Sorry to jump in and be somewhat off topic, but I had thought. 

It would be interesting if users filled in a profile of their interests and 
skills (not to mention their blog feed etc perhaps). Ideas for questions could 
probably be gleaned from resume posting sites. (I can program in: o Perl, o 
Python, o Etc...)

Based on this profile FAS groups, mailings lists, etc could be suggested. At 
the same time project leaders could mine accounts looking for potential 
helpers. It would basically be a more structured self-introduction email with 
more staying power.
